* Celsius is the metric temperature scale, often abbreviated as "C".
* Fahrenheit is the imperial temperature scale, often abbreviated as "F".
To convert Celsius to Fahrenheit, use this formula:
F = (C * 9/5) + 32
Let's say you meant to ask: What is 80 degrees Celsius in Fahrenheit?
Here's how to calculate it:
* F = (80 * 9/5) + 32
* F = 144 + 32
* F = 176
Therefore, 80 degrees Celsius is equal to 176 degrees Fahrenheit.
